Idlewild Open returns for it's 5th year on the Disc Golf Pro Tour. presented by Dynamic Discs and hosted by The Nati Disc Golf and their excellent staff. Known by most as the most challenging and difficult course on tour, this beast has it all. Elevation changes on numerous holes may help or add to your required distance. Punishing rough lined fairways grab errant shots with no remorse. The snake like creek that slithers through several holes increases the risk of adding strokes as well as constricting greens on a few baskets. Shot accuracy and placement take a higher priority then just raw distance. Weather conditions have also played a big factor in our first two years and will most likely continue it's dreaded rein. No lead is safe going down the final stretch of holes. Join us this summer for another exciting event at Idlewild.

3. On site RV and Van parking: Shelters 1,2,3 have electric service, only 20amp. Will be first come first serve. Shelters 1 & 2 are located by the parking lot on the right just after the the left turn headed to the course. Shelter 3 is located across the Pond from DGPT holes 4 & 5.
There is another area that RV's or tents can be setup at. Once entering the Park, continue straight, down the hill, first road on your right will take you back to this area, parking lot and gravel section for our use.

Public Play: Just a friendly reminder that the disc golf course at Idlewild Park will be closed to the public for casual play from Friday August 6th through Monday August 16th for the Idlewild Open. Amateur Weekend Competition is 8/6-8/8, then the DGPT Practice and Competition week is 8/9-8/16.
